I put the block upside down in the back of my station wagon on some boards and assembled the engine up to the flywheel. I then mounted the holder from the engine stand to the rear plate. I jacked the back of the car until it was high enough to slide the stand on the bracket. When I lowered the car, the engine was on the stand. One person operation.
